Senior Field Mechanical Engineer
Location: Cedar Rapids, IA
Department: Overwatch Mission Critical
Location Type: IN_OFFICE
Employment Type: FULL_TIME
- Represent the owner on all mechanical engineering and construction matters.
- Provide field oversight of chilled-water systems, HVAC equipment, CRAH/CRAC units, air-handling systems, cooling towers, pumps, piping, controls, and associated infrastructure.
- Verify installations comply with approved drawings, specifications, owner project requirements, submittals, and applicable codes.
- Conduct regular field walks to assess installation quality, constructability, progress, safety concerns, and commissioning readiness.
- Identify design conflicts, installation deficiencies, and operational risks before they affect the project schedule or system performance.
- Review and support the resolution of RFIs, submittals, field change requests, nonconformance reports, and design clarifications.
- Monitor pressure testing, flushing, cleaning, TAB, equipment startup, and functional testing.
- Track mechanical issues through resolution and verify corrective work has been completed properly.
- Support punch-list development, system turnover, and final acceptance.
- Serve as the primary field liaison between the owner, design engineers, general contractor, mechanical trade partners, commissioning team, controls vendors, and facility operations personnel.
- Communicate field conditions and technical concerns clearly to design teams and recommend practical solutions.
- Participate in design reviews, constructability reviews, coordination meetings, and technical workshops.
- Evaluate proposed design changes for potential effects on reliability, maintainability, cost, schedule, commissioning, and facility operations.
- Ensure design intent is accurately translated into installed mechanical systems.
- Coordinate mechanical requirements with electrical, structural, architectural, controls, fire-protection, and civil disciplines.
- Escalate critical technical and schedule risks to project leadership with clear recommendations and supporting documentation.
- Align construction decisions with the owner’s long-term operational and reliability standards.
- Coordinate with commissioning teams to confirm mechanical systems are ready for startup and testing.
- Review pre-functional checklists, test procedures, commissioning scripts, and turnover documentation.
- Support equipment startup, functional performance testing, integrated systems testing, and issue resolution.
- Verify commissioning deficiencies are properly documented, assigned, tracked, and closed.
- Support the turnover of completed systems to facility operations teams.
- Review as-built drawings, operations and maintenance manuals, training records, warranties, and closeout documentation for accuracy and completeness.
- Provide technical direction and day-to-day mentorship to junior field engineers.
- Help junior team members develop skills in drawing and specification review, field inspections, issue identification, technical documentation, and stakeholder communication.
- Delegate assignments appropriately while maintaining oversight of quality and completion.
- Review junior engineers’ field reports, technical assessments, and recommendations.
- Model professional communication, sound engineering judgment, accountability, and proactive issue resolution.
- Lead technical discussions and build alignment among design, construction, commissioning, and operations stakeholders.
- Serve as the escalation point for complex mechanical issues.
- 5-10+ years of field mechanical engineering experience
- Significant experience supporting large-scale data center, or mission-critical construction
- Strong knowledge of chilled-water plants, HVAC systems, CRAH/CRAC units, pumps, piping, cooling towers, ventilation systems, TAB, and building controls.
- Experience reviewing mechanical drawings, specifications, submittals, RFIs, equipment selections, and field changes.
- Experience coordinating with engineers of record, design consultants, general contractors, trade partners, commissioning agents, and facility operations teams.
- Demonstrated ability to mentor junior engineers and provide technical leadership.
- Strong understanding of construction sequencing, startup, commissioning, integrated testing, and system turnover.
- Ability to translate complex technical issues into clear recommendations for technical and nontechnical stakeholders.
- Strong written communication, documentation, and issue-management skills.
- Ability to work full-time onsite in an active construction environment.
